RF AMP & SERVO SIGNAL PROCESSOR
OVERVIEW
The KB9223 is a 1-chip BICMOS integrated circuit to per-
form the function of RF amp and servo signal processor for
compact disc player applications.It consist of blocks for RF
signal processing ,focus, tracking, sled and spindle
servo.Also this IC has adjustment free function and embed-
ded opamp for audio post filter.

Table 1. PIN DESCRIPTION (Continued)
Pin No. Symbol
Description
27 FS3 The pin for high frequency gain change of focus loop with internal FS3 switch
28
FGD
Reducing high frequency gain with capacitor between FS3 pin
29 LOCK Sled runaway prevention pin
30 TRCNT Track count output pin
31 ISTAT Internal status output pin
32
ASY
The input pin for asymmetry control
33
EFM
EFM comparator output pin
34 VSSA Analog VSS for servo part
35
MCK
Micom clock input pin
36 MDATA Micom data input pin
37
MLT
Micom data latch input pin
38 RESET Reset input pin
39 MIRROR The mirror output for test
40
FOK
The output pin of focus OK comparator
61
TGU
The capacitor connection pin for high frequency tracking gain switch
62 TG2 The pin for high frequency gain change of tracking servo loop with internal TG2 switch
63 FEBIAS Focus error bias voltage control pin
64 DVEE The DVEE pin for logic circuit
65
PD1
The negative input pin of RF I/V amplifier1(A+C signal)
66
PD2
The negative input pin of RF I/V amplifier2(B+D signal)
67 F The negative input pin of F I/V amplifier (F signal)
68 E The negative input pin of E I/V amplifier(E signal)
69 PD The input pin for APC
70 LD The output pin for APC
71 VR The output pin of (AVEE+AVCC)/2 voltage
72
VCC
VCC for RF part
73 RF- RF summing amplifier inverting input pin
74
RFO
RF summing amplifier output pin
